Adage Capital Partners GP L.L.C. bought a new position in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c. (NASDAQ:PNFP - Free Report) during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or bought 29,000 shares of the financial services provider's stock, valued at approximately $3,075,000.
A number of other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also recently made changes to their positions in the company. Dark Forest Capital Management LP purchased a new position in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ners during the 1st quarter worth approximately $4,338,000. Graham Capital Management L.P. purchased a new position in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ners during the 1st quarter worth approximately $1,426,000. Junto Capital Management LP grew its holdings in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ners by 28.7% during the 1st quarter. Junto Capital Management LP now owns 446,076 shares of the financial services provider's stock worth $47,302,000 after acquiring an additional 99,495 shares during the period. Azora Capital LP grew its holdings in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ners by 9.2% during the 1st quarter. Azora Capital LP now owns 998,474 shares of the financial services provider's stock worth $105,878,000 after acquiring an additional 84,538 shares during the period. Finally, Kodai Capital Management LP purchased a new position in sh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ners during the 1st quarter worth approximately $5,639,000. Hedge funds and other institutional investors own 87.40% of the company's stock.
Analysts Set New Price Targets
Several equities analysts have recently issued reports on the stock. UBS Group lowered their target price on sh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ners from $121.00 to $108.00 and set a "neutral" rating for the company in a report on Tuesday, September 2nd. Stephens lowered their target price on sh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ners from $133.00 to $104.00 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a report on Tuesday, July 29th. Wells Fargo & Company lowered their target price on sh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ners from $125.00 to $110.00 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a report on Friday, July 25th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ods lowered their target price on sh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ners from $125.00 to $95.00 and set a "market perform" rating for the company in a report on Wednesday, August 13th. Finally, Citigroup lowered their target price on shares of Pinnacle Financial Partners from $140.00 to $120.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a report on Friday, July 25th. Four invest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and six have issued a Hold r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the company presently has a consensus rating of "Hold" and a consensus target price of $113.50.

Pinnacle Financial Partners Stock Performance
NASDAQ:PNFP traded down $0.49 during trading hours on Friday, reaching $97.32. The company had a trading volume of 391,981 shares, compared to its average volume of 777,522. The company has a current ratio of 0.89, a quick ratio of 0.88 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.34.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c. has a 52 week low of $81.57 and a 52 week high of $131.91. The firm has a market cap of $7.55 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 12.89 and a beta of 1.07. The firm's 50 day moving average price is $100.25 and its 200-day moving average price is $102.88.
Pinnacle Financial Partners (NASDAQ:PNFP -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 15th. The financial services provider reported $2.00 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$1.92 by $0.08. Pinnacle Financial Partners had a net margin of 18.69% and a return on equity of 9.60%. The firm had revenue of $504.99 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$495.27 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$1.63 EPS.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 15.1%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ts forecast that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c. will post 7.85 EPS for the current year.
Pinnacle Financial Partners Announces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, August 29th. Stockholders of record on Friday, August 1st were given a dividend of $0.24 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, August 1st. This represents a $0.96 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.0%. Pinnacle Financial Partners's payout ratio is presently 12.73%.

About Pinnacle Financial Partners

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as the bank holding company for Pinnacle Bank that provides various banking products and services to individuals, businesses, and professional entities in the United States. The company accepts various deposits, including savings, noninterest-bearing and interest-bearing checking, money market, and certificate of deposit accounts; and provides treasury management services, which includes online wire origination, enhanced ACH origination services, positive pay, zero balance and sweep accounts, automated bill pay services, electronic receivables processing, lockbox processing, and merchant card acceptance services.
